Am on a mid 2015 Macbook Pro, all software updated with Intel Iris Pro 1536 MB and AMD Radeon R9 M370X 2048 MB Graphics cards (no updates available).  After placing markers on my photos the program crashes while building the 3D face. Have submitted a ticket but no response yet and I need to resolve it for an urgent project. I see a lot of posts about this crash, mostly directed to tech support and haven't found a solution that works for my system.
Am also getting an awful background noise on audio files I import. Like a screeching car crash.

Sorry to hear you are experiencing problems with CrazyTalk 8.

You should hear back soon from Technical Support who will be able to advise you with this issue. Replies are normally within 48 hours Monday - Friday. One thing to check is that you are using the latest version which is 8.03. You can do this by going to Help > Check For Update in CT8. If you are not using the latest version, please update.
